Essential Duties
75% of each day is dedicated to managerial and supervisory duties
Develops schedules for all food and beverage departments, according to budget and forecast
Works closely with the kitchen leadership to ensure food quality and consistency, and appropriate ticket times, labor and cost of sales
Assists in the completion of all month end inventories to include the kitchen, bars, and beverage cart
Assists the Director, Food and Beverage with budget development and cost analysis
Assists in the marketing of the restaurant, both internal and external
Assists in the managing other managers, and front line associates, in all food and beverage outlets
Manages service standards for all food and beverage outlets
Promotes and implements all Troon food and beverage standards, procedures and policies
Assists and leads interviewing, hiring, training, planning, assigning, and directing work, evaluating performance, communicates opportunities, praise, progressive performance documentations of all food and beverage associates; addressing complaints and resolving issues
Manages department members that may include, but is not limited to: Restaurant Manager, Bar Supervisor, Host, Set Up Staff, Cooks, Servers, Bartenders, Bussers, Food Runners, and any other food and beverage associates
Assures that effective orientation and training are given to each new associate. Develops ongoing training programs and tests for comprehension
Monitors business volume forecast and plans accordingly in areas of labor, productivity, costs and other expenses
Incorporates safe work practices in job performance
Regular and reliable attendance
Performs other duties as required

About Troon
Founded in 1990 and headquartered in Scottsdale, AZ, Troon is the world’s largest professional club management company, that specializes in services in golf, hospitality, and residential communities. With more than 900 locations in 45+ states and 27+ countries, Troon is a leading employer in hospitality.
